Ultrasound-guided percutaneous microwave ablation for hepatocellular carcinoma: clinical outcomes and prognostic factors.

OBJECTIVE: The aim of this study was to evaluate the clinical outcomes of ultrasound-guided percutaneous microwave ablation (US-guided PMWA) for the treatment of hepatocellular carcinoma (HCC) with the analysis of prognostic factors.

MATERIALS AND METHODS: The treatment and survival parameters of 433 patients with HCC (≤10 cm), who met the inclusion criteria and had received US-guided PMWA in Renji Hospital from July 2010 to November 2014, were retrospectively analyzed. Imaging examination (contrast-enhanced CT or MR) and tumor markers (AFP and CA199) 1 month after MWA were used to evaluate the efficacy of US-guided PMWA. SPSS software was used to perform all statistical analyses.

RESULTS: The initial complete ablation (CA) rate was 94.9 % (411/433). Twenty-two patients with incomplete ablation received repeat PMWA, and the total CA rate was up to 98.6 % (427/433). Multiple tumor number, tumor >5 cm in diameter, and higher serum AFP level (>20 ng/ml) were significant unfavorable prognosticators of progression-free survival (PFS). The cumulative 1-, 2-, and 3-year overall survival (OS) rates were 83.5, 66.1, and 58.7 %, respectively (median: 43 months). Tumor >5 cm in diameter and serum AFP >400 ng/ml were significant unfavorable prognosticators of OS.

CONCLUSIONS: PMWA is well tolerated in HCC patients and capable of offering high CA rate. Tumor number, tumor size, and AFP level were significant prognosticators of patients' PFS, whereas tumor size and AFP level were significant prognosticators of OS.
